WIC Reset Utility—short for "Waste Ink Counters Reset Utility"—is a software tool designed to perform service procedures on inkjet printers, primarily Epson and Canon models. Printer manufacturers build waste ink counters into their devices to track how much excess ink the printer's internal cleaning cycles have generated. These counters are tied to physical waste ink pads—sponges inside the printer that absorb excess ink during printhead cleaning and other maintenance operations.

The official WIC (Waste Ink Counter) Reset Utility is a legitimate diagnostic software. It allows users to read the waste ink counters for free, but resetting the counter to 0% requires purchasing a one-time use digital key.
